What is the slope and y- intercept for -10x+3y-6=10

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 02-03-2022

Answer:

Slope = m = 10/3 and y-intercept = (0, 16/3)

Step-by-step explanation:

-10x + 3y - 6 = 10

3y = 10x + 16

y = 10/3x + 16/3

Slope = m = 10/3

y-intercept = (0, 16/3)
